在数字化转型的浪潮中,数据开发已成为企业核心竞争力的重要组成部分。然而,传统数据开发模式面临着数据量大、复杂度高、效率低下的挑战。为了应对这些挑战,人工智能(AI)技术逐渐成为数据开发领域的强大助力。AI辅助数据开发不仅能够显著提升开发效率,还能优化数据质量,为企业创造更大的价值。本文将深入探讨AI辅助数据开发的核心价值、技术解决方案以及其在数据中台、数字孪生和数字可视化等领域的实际应用。
一、AI辅助数据开发的核心价值
AI辅助数据开发通过引入智能化工具和技术,显著提升了数据开发的效率和准确性。以下是其核心价值的几个方面:
1. 自动化数据处理
AI能够自动识别和处理数据中的异常值、缺失值和重复数据,从而减少人工干预。例如,通过机器学习算法,AI可以自动清洗数据,确保数据的完整性和一致性。
2. 智能模型生成
AI辅助工具可以帮助数据开发人员快速生成和优化数据模型。通过分析历史数据和业务需求,AI可以推荐最优的模型架构,并自动调整参数以提高模型性能。
3. 异常检测与预警
AI算法能够实时监控数据流,快速识别潜在的异常情况并发出预警。这不仅提高了数据开发的稳定性,还能帮助企业及时发现和解决问题。
4. 优化建议
AI可以根据历史数据和业务目标,为数据开发人员提供优化建议。例如,AI可以推荐最佳的数据分区策略或索引优化方案,从而提升数据查询效率。
二、AI辅助数据开发的技术解决方案
为了实现AI辅助数据开发,企业需要结合多种技术手段,构建高效的数据开发平台。以下是几种关键技术解决方案:
1. 机器学习与深度学习
- 数据预处理:利用机器学习算法自动清洗和转换数据,减少人工操作。
- 模型优化:通过深度学习技术,AI可以自动调整模型参数,提升模型的准确性和性能。
2. 自然语言处理(NLP)
- 需求分析:通过NLP技术,AI可以理解业务需求文档,自动生成数据处理逻辑。
- 代码生成:AI可以根据自然语言描述生成相应的代码片段,显著提升开发效率。
3. 自动化工具与平台
- 自动化工作流:构建自动化数据处理工作流,实现从数据采集到分析的全流程自动化。
- 可视化开发界面:提供友好的可视化界面,方便数据开发人员快速配置和管理开发任务。
4. 分布式计算框架
- 高效数据处理:利用分布式计算框架(如Spark、Flink等),AI可以快速处理大规模数据,提升数据开发效率。
- 资源优化:AI可以根据任务需求动态分配计算资源,确保最优性能。
三、AI辅助数据开发在数据中台的应用
数据中台是企业实现数据资产化和数据驱动决策的核心平台。AI辅助数据开发在数据中台中的应用,可以显著提升数据中台的效率和价值。
1. 数据集成与治理
- 数据集成:AI可以帮助数据中台自动集成来自不同源的数据,并进行格式转换和标准化处理。
- 数据治理:通过AI技术,数据中台可以自动识别数据质量问题,并提供修复建议。
2. 数据建模与分析
- 智能建模:AI可以根据业务需求自动生成数据模型,并提供模型性能评估和优化建议。
- 实时分析:AI可以实时分析数据中台中的数据,提供动态的业务洞察。
3. 数据服务化
- API生成:AI可以根据数据中台中的数据,自动生成API接口,方便其他系统调用。
- 动态数据服务:AI可以根据业务需求动态调整数据服务,确保数据服务的灵活性和高效性。
四、AI辅助数据开发在数字孪生中的应用
数字孪生是将物理世界与数字世界进行实时映射的技术,广泛应用于智能制造、智慧城市等领域。AI辅助数据开发在数字孪生中的应用,可以提升数字孪生的实时性和准确性。
1. 实时数据处理
- 数据采集与处理:AI可以帮助数字孪生系统实时采集和处理传感器数据,确保数据的实时性和准确性。
- 动态模型更新:AI可以根据实时数据自动更新数字孪生模型,提升模型的动态适应能力。
2. 预测与优化
- 预测分析:AI可以通过分析历史数据和实时数据,预测未来趋势,并为数字孪生系统提供优化建议。
- 决策支持:AI可以根据数字孪生模型的输出结果,为业务决策提供支持。
3. 可视化与交互
- 动态可视化:AI可以帮助数字孪生系统生成动态的可视化界面,方便用户实时监控和操作。
- 智能交互:AI可以根据用户需求,提供个性化的交互体验,提升用户满意度。
五、AI辅助数据开发在数字可视化中的应用
数字可视化是将数据转化为图形、图表等可视化形式的技术,广泛应用于数据分析、业务监控等领域。AI辅助数据开发在数字可视化中的应用,可以提升可视化的效率和效果。
1. 自动化图表生成
- 智能图表推荐:AI可以根据数据特征和业务需求,自动推荐合适的图表类型。
- 动态图表更新:AI可以根据实时数据自动更新图表内容,确保可视化内容的实时性。
2. 数据洞察挖掘
- 智能分析:AI可以通过分析可视化数据,发现潜在的业务洞察,并为用户提供决策建议。
- 趋势预测:AI可以根据历史数据和实时数据,预测未来趋势,并生成相应的可视化结果。
3. 用户交互优化
- 个性化推荐:AI可以根据用户行为和偏好,推荐相关的可视化内容,提升用户体验。
- 智能交互设计:AI可以根据用户需求,自动生成交互式可视化界面,方便用户操作。
六、案例分析:AI辅助数据开发的实际应用
为了更好地理解AI辅助数据开发的价值,我们来看一个实际案例:
某电商平台通过引入AI辅助数据开发技术,显著提升了数据开发效率。通过AI工具,数据开发人员可以快速清洗和处理海量数据,并自动生成优化的模型。此外,AI还可以实时监控数据流,快速识别异常情况并发出预警。通过这些技术,该电商平台的数据开发效率提升了40%,数据准确性也显著提高。
七、结论与展望
AI辅助数据开发正在成为企业数据开发的重要趋势。通过引入智能化工具和技术,企业可以显著提升数据开发效率、优化数据质量,并为企业创造更大的价值。未来,随着AI技术的不断发展,AI辅助数据开发将在更多领域得到广泛应用,为企业数字化转型提供更强有力的支持。
申请试用&https://www.dtstack.com/?src=bbs
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。